摘要:

A novel Josephson logic gate achieving high gain, employing current injection, and having a noninterferometer configuration has been proposed and studied. The gate includes three small junctions for input sensing, output driving, and I‐O isolation. The junctions are appropriately biased by source resistors to obtain high current gain. Computer simulation and preliminary experiment have demonstrated that a current gain higher than 2 can easily be obtained through the proposed configuration.
